Method of performing autofocus, autofocus system, and camera comprising an autofocus module
US-2018074287-A1 · Mar 15, 2018 · US
US11061202B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-11061202-B2 |
| Application number | US-201916416945-A |
| Country | US |
| Kind code | B2 |
| Filing date | May 20, 2019 |
| Priority date | May 30, 2018 |
| Publication date | Jul 13, 2021 |
| Grant date | Jul 13, 2021 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A method for adjusting lens position, includes: controlling a lens in a photographing component to be sequentially located at m first lens positions during a focusing process, and acquiring a first definition of an image captured by the photographing component at each of the first lens positions, where m≥3; selecting a first relationship curve in a focusing curve library according to a matching condition, the focusing curve library including at least two relationship curves between definitions and lens positions captured at different focusing distances, and the matching condition being used to indicate a degree of similarity between the m first lens positions as well as the first definitions and the relationship curves; and controlling the lens to be located at a target lens position corresponding to a maximum definition indicated by the first relationship curve.
Opening claim text (preview).
What is claimed is: 1. A method for adjusting lens position, including: controlling a lens in a photographing component to be sequentially located at m first lens positions during a focusing process, and acquiring a first definition of an image captured by the photographing component at each of the first lens positions, where m is an integer no less than 3; selecting a first relationship curve in a focusing curve library according to a matching condition, the focusing curve library including at least two relationship curves between definitions and lens positions captured at different focusing distances, and the matching condition indicating a degree of similarity between a first definition curve and the relationship curves, wherein the first definition curve is defined by the m first lens positions and the first definitions; and controlling the lens to move to a target lens position corresponding to a maximum definition indicated by the first relationship curve. 2. The method according to claim 1 , wherein selecting the first relationship curve in the focusing curve library according to the matching condition comprises: identifying m second definitions corresponding to the m first lens positions in each relationship curve in the focusing curve library; for each of the m first lens positions, obtaining a difference between each first definition and each second definition; and selecting the first relationship curve where the difference between each first definition and each second definition is less than a definition threshold. 3. The method according to claim 2 , further comprising: acquiring reference definitions of images captured by the photographing component at multiple reference lens positions, the multiple reference lens positions being multiple lens positions under the same focusing distance; performing curve fitting according to the multiple reference lens positions and the acquired reference definitions to obtain a second relationship curve; and storing the second relationship curve in the focusing curve library. 4. The method according to claim 2 , wherein the m first lens positions are all located on an optical axis of the lens, and the method further comprises: determining whether a predetermined condition is established when the first relationship curve cannot be found in the focusing curve library, the predetermined condition includes: the first definition of the image captured by the photographing component at the second lens position being the highest for three consecutive lens positions among the m first lens positions; when the predetermined condition is established, controlling the lens to be sequentially located at n second lens positions, and acquiring a third definition of an image captured by the photographing component at each of the second lens positions, where n≥1, the second lens position being located between the first lens position and a third lens position which are on the optical axis of the lens; and controlling the lens to move to the second lens position where a maximum third definition can be acquired. 5. The method according to claim 4 , further comprising: performing curve fitting according to the m first lens positions, the m first definitions of the images acquired at the m first lens positions, the n second lens positions and the n third definitions of the images captured at the n second lens positions to obtain a third relationship curve; and adding the third relationship curve into the focusing curve library. 6. The method according to claim 1 , wherein the number of relationship curves in the focusing curve library is greater than or equal to a predetermined threshold of number. 7. The method according to claim 1 , wherein the step of controlling the lens in the photographing component to be sequentially located at the m first lens positions includes: controlling the lens to move m−1 steps from current position in a fixed step size to enable the lens to be sequentially moved to m−1 positions, wherein the m first lens positions include the current position and the m−1 positions. 8. The method according to claim 1 , wherein m is less than 5. 9. A device for adjusting lens position, comprising: a first controller configured to control a lens in a photographing component to be sequentially located at m first lens positions, during a focusing process, and acquire a first definition of an image captured by the photographing component at each of the first lens positions, where m is an integer no less than 3; a look-up circuitry configured to look up a first relationship curve in a focusing curve library according to a matching condition, the focusing curve library including at least two relationship curves between definitions and lens positions captured at different focusing distances, and the matching condition indicating a degree of similarity between a first definition curve and the relationship curves, wherein the first definition curve is defined by the m first lens positions and the first definitions; and a second controller configured to control the lens to move to a target lens position corresponding to the maximum definition indicated by the first relationship curve. 10. The device according to claim 9 , wherein the matching condition includes: a difference between the first definition corresponding to the first lens position and a second definition being less than a definition threshold for each of the m first lens positions, and the second definition being a definition, which corresponds to the first lens position, in the first relationship curve. 11. The device according to claim 10 , further comprising: an acquisition circuitry configured to acquire reference definitions of images captured by the photographing component at multiple reference lens positions, the multiple reference lens positions being multiple lens positions under the same focusing distance; a first curve fitting circuitry configured to perform curve fitting according to the multiple reference lens positions and the acquired reference definitions to obtain a second relationship curve; and a storage configured to store the second relationship curve in the focusing curve library. 12. The device according to claim 10 , further comprising: a determiner configured to determine whether a predetermined condition is established when the first relationship curve cannot be found in the focusing curve library, the predetermined condition includes: the first definition of the image captured by the photographing component at the second lens position being the highest for three consecutive lens positions among the m first lens positions; a third controller configured to, when the predetermined condition is established, control the lens to be sequentially located at n second lens positions, and acquire a third definition of an image captured by the photographing component at each of the second lens positions, where n≥1, the second lens position being located between the first lens position and a third lens position which are on the optical axis of the lens; and a fourth controller configured to control the lens to move to the second lens position where a maximum third definition can be acquired. 13. The device according to claim 12 , further comprising: a second curve fitting circuitry configured to perform curve fitting according to the m first lens positions, the m first definitions of the images acquired at the m first lens positions, the n second lens positions and the n third definitions of the images captured at the n second lens positions to obtain a third relationship curve; and an adder configured to add the third re
based on contrast or high frequency components of image signals, e.g. hill climbing method · CPC title
Focus control based on electronic image sensor signals · CPC title
Arrangement of cameras or camera modules, e.g. multiple cameras in TV studios or sports stadiums · CPC title
Autofocus systems · CPC title
Systems for automatic generation of focusing signals ·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.